The Hype Cycle for Emerging Technologies 2023 presents a visual representation of technology maturity trends, focusing on innovation timelines. Emerging technologies such as artificial intelligence (AI), blockchain, and the Internet of Things (IoT) dominate this year’s cycle, showcasing both promise and challenges.
Several phases define the Hype Cycle. The initial phase, Innovation Trigger, signifies a breakthrough, generating excitement around a new technology. In 2023, AI models, like generative AI, fall under this phase, captivating interest across various industries. Next, the Peak of Inflated Expectations captures the enthusiasm before skepticism sets in. Blockchain initiatives experience this phase, with desires for widespread adoption conflicting with regulatory complexities.
During the Trough of Disillusionment, interest wanes as challenges emerge. Technology leaders confront scalability and integration issues with blockchain, causing stakeholders to reconsider timelines. As advancements occur, technologies shift to the Slope of Enlightenment, where practical applications gain traction. AI, particularly in automation and data analysis, finds its footing here, demonstrating tangible benefits for businesses.
Finally, the Plateau of Productivity reflects widespread acceptance and deployment. Technologies reaching this stage, such as cloud computing, exhibit proven value and increased usability. Understanding these phases helps innovators and investors gauge where to allocate resources, balancing risks and rewards.

Innovation Trigger
Breakthroughs like generative AI initiate the Innovation Trigger phase, generating significant excitement. Innovations demonstrate potential applications but often lack maturity. Stakeholders begin to invest time and resources into early development. Furthermore, emerging technologies attract attention as they capture imagination and spark enthusiasm.
Peak of Inflated Expectations
Blockchain initiatives reach the Peak of Inflated Expectations, where optimism is at its height. Early successes fuel exaggerated beliefs in capabilities, leading to heightened interest. Consequently, startups and investors flock to explore perceived opportunities. However, challenges arise from regulatory complexities, impacting sustained growth.
Trough of Disillusionment
During the Trough of Disillusionment, enthusiasm wanes as early adopters confront harsh realities. Scalability issues and unmet expectations emerge, leading to skepticism. Projects falter when results do not align with inflated promises. Many technologies find it difficult to recover from this phase.
Slope of Enlightenment
The Slope of Enlightenment marks a renewed understanding of technologies, particularly in automation and data analysis. Early adopters share lessons learned, guiding further development. Knowledge accumulates, allowing innovators to refine approaches. Incremental advancements lead to increasing acceptance across industries and sectors.
Plateau of Productivity
Finally, the Plateau of Productivity signifies widespread acceptance of matured technologies, including cloud computing. Organizations recognize the value these tools provide, resulting in mainstream adoption. Productivity enhancements become evident as applications integrate into existing workflows. Market leaders begin to emerge, establishing footholds in established sectors.
